Output 98ee032361b4b80e2a2e0f1f7ea32f3e3f0e95553bcb81aa79b689957289afbe:2

value
6062510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c455fa6d35cdf7a0956347651ced4ca7e186c34 OP_EQUAL
address
37BhaDdRfvgCK6cPJPiiGc6KdtX23bSctB
transaction
98ee032361b4b80e2a2e0f1f7ea32f3e3f0e95553bcb81aa79b689957289afbe
confirmations
498063
spent
true